* fixed wrong byte order in DrawingModeAlphaCC
* added another optimized bitmap drawing routine for B_OP_ALPHA and BGR[A]32 bitmaps. When actual blending takes place, it is more than 1.7 times faster than R5, and about the same speed when the bitmap is fully opaque. git-svn-id: file:///srv/svn/repos/haiku/haiku/trunk@15761 a95241bf-73f2-0310-859d-f6bbb57e9c96
